一个服务器是接受和响应通过网络发出的请求的软件或硬件设备。发出请求并从服务器接收响应的设备称为客户端。在 Internet 上,术语“服务器”通常是指接收 Web 文件请求并将这些文件发送到客户端的计算机系统。
它们是做什么用的?
服务器管理网络资源。例如,用户可以设置服务器来控制对网络的访问、发送/接收电子邮件、管理打印作业或托管网站。他们还擅长进行密集的计算。一些服务器致力于特定任务,通常称为专用。但是,今天的许多服务器都是共享服务器,它们承担了电子邮件、DNS、FTP的职责,甚至在 Web 服务器的情况下,它们还负责多个网站。
为什么服务器总是开着?
因为它们通常用于提供经常需要的服务,所以大多数服务器永远不会关闭。因此,当服务器出现故障时,它们会给网络用户和公司带来许多问题。为了缓解这些问题,服务器通常设置为具有容错功能。
其他计算机如何连接到服务器?
通过本地网络,服务器连接到网络上所有其他计算机使用的路由器或交换机。一旦连接到网络,其他计算机就可以访问该服务器及其功能。例如,使用 Web 服务器,用户可以连接到服务器以查看网站、搜索并与网络上的其他用户通信。Internet 服务器的工作方式与本地网络服务器的工作方式相同,但规模要大得多。服务器由InterNIC或Web 主机分配一个IP 地址。
通常,用户使用在域名注册商处注册的域名连接到服务器。当用户连接到该域名(例如“mfisp.com”)时,该名称会被DNS 解析器自动转换为服务器的 IP 地址。域名使用户更容易连接到服务器,因为名称比 IP 地址更容易记住。此外,域名使服务器运营商能够在不中断用户访问服务器的方式的情况下更改服务器的 IP 地址。即使 IP 地址发生变化,域名也可以始终保持不变。
服务器存储在哪里?
在商业或公司环境中,服务器和其他网络设备通常存放在壁橱或玻璃房中。这些区域有助于将敏感的计算机和设备与不应访问它们的人隔离开。远程或不在现场托管的服务器位于数据中心。使用这些类型的服务器,硬件由另一家公司管理,并由您或您的公司远程配置。
我的电脑可以当服务器吗?
是的。任何计算机,甚至是家用台式机或膝上型计算机,都可以作为具有正确软件的服务器。例如,您可以在您的计算机上安装一个FTP服务器程序,以便在您网络上的其他用户之间共享文件。尽管可以将您的家用计算机用作服务器,但请记住以下想法。
- 您的计算机和相关服务器软件必须始终运行才能访问。
- 当您的计算机用作服务器时,它的资源(例如,处理和带宽)会从您可以用来做其他事情的资源中拿走。
- 将计算机连接到网络和 Internet 会使您的计算机容易受到新型攻击。
- 如果您提供的服务变得流行,典型的计算机可能没有处理所有请求的必要资源。